Tip of the Day: Common Sense Tip for Christmas Lights

100 Light Set Superbright Clear/Green Cord

This next Tip of the Day seems quite obvious. However, I cannot tell you how many times I have spoken to frustrated customers during their checkout or when processing an exchange. At this time of year, we sell a lot of Christmas light sets. One simple step can save you a lot of time and frustration.

Check to make sure your light set works before installing them!

Depending on how you install them into your Christmas tree, wreath, or garland, it can be both time consuming and really frustrating to have to take them out and replace them. Some people end up trying to find the problem. If you have ever had a set go out, you will know that trying to find the bad bulb, connection, or fuse is not a pleasant experience. This is much easier to accomplish if the light set has not been installed and is in front of you. Better yet, you can take them back as defective.
